Hi there. I'm new to iOS products. Currently an Android user, but am hoping to make the switch to iPads. However, I have a scenario that I use on the Android tablet that I need to be able to do on an iPad and I'm hoping someone can help me find the solution.

I need to have the iPad sync a folder (and all subfolders and files) from a cloud service (doesn't have to be iCloud) to the iPad's internal storage, so the files can be accessed when offline. It would be a bonus if I could schedule this sync to happen at certain times of the day (when I know the tablet will be in a WiFi zone). The sync only needs to happen one way - from cloud storage to iPad internal storage.

On Android, I used an app called FolderSync and it worked very well. However, I could not find this same app in the App Store.

Does anyone know of a way this can be done on iOS? The iPad currently has iOS 14.7.1, but am happy to update to iOS 15, if it's a requirement.

I use FileBrowser Pro and synch a folder plus subfolders from Dropbox to my iPad Pro (I just do it one way). The synch time is set up as a frequency - every 1, 4, 8, 12, or 24 hours.

Documents by Readdle can do this from a multitude of cloud/server solutions too.
